#53FD81 Color
#53FD81 is rgb(83, 253, 129) in RGB, hsl(136, 98%, 66%) in HSL, and about cmyk(67%, 0%, 49%, 1%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Spring Green (#00FF7F),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 8.02.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

#53FD81 Channel Values
How #53FD81 bre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 83 · G 253 · B 129 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 136° · S 98% · L 66%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 136° · S 67% · V 99%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 67% · M 0% · Y 49% · K 1%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 1.33:1 vs white · 15.73: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#53FD81 background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#53FD81 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#53FD81?
#53FD81 is a light green — rgb(83, 253, 129) in RGB and hsl(136, 98%, 66%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Spring Green (#00FF7F),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 8.02.
What is the RGB value of #53FD81?
#53FD81 is rgb(83, 253, 129) — red 83, green 253, and blue 129 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#53FD81?
#53FD81 converts to approximately cmyk(67%, 0%, 49%, 1%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#53FD81 be black or white?
Black text is the more readable choice. #53FD81 scores 1.33:1 against white and 15.73: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#53FD81 as a CSS color keyword?
No. #53FD81 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is springgreen (#00FF7F) at a CIE76 distance of 8.02, which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side.
